Advantages of Community Power

With the new Community Power Energy Plans, you will be eligible for rebates of up to $300 on your electricity bills over 3 years - minimising the cost of reducing your home's impact on our environment.

Purchasing GreenPower is a simple and effective action households, businesses and organisations can take to reduce the level of their individual greenhouse emissions. By signing up to an Community Power Energy Plan, you become part of a local initiative that is taking action on a local level.

GreenPower is Government accredited - ensuring that the energy comes from renewable sources such as wind and solar. By choosing government accredited renewable energy you can be certain that your efforts are reducing your greenhouse emissions, and actively supporting the development of Australia’s renewable energy industry.

Want to know how much the Community Power Energy Plans will cost you per year?*

Step 1:
Identify your average daily electricity usage (or closest to your actual usage) on the table below.

How?

Your average daily usage will be on your electricity bill, usually near a picture of a bar graph. Remember that your bills can vary throughout the year depending on the season and what appliances are being used. Winter bills can be higher than average due to more lighting, heating and hot water being used.

Step 2:
Choose what percentage of your home's electricity consumption you want sourced from renewable GreenPower sources.

Where the row from Step 1 intersects with the column from Step 2, this will indicate the additional cost, before rebates.
